excel里怎么求等级

excel里怎么求等级

在Excel中,求等级的方法有多个,最常见的有:使用IF函数、使用VLOOKUP函数、使用RANK函数。这里我们详细讲解如何使用这几种方法来求等级,以便你可以根据具体需求选择最合适的方法。

一、IF函数求等级

IF函数 是Excel中最常用的逻辑函数之一,它可以根据指定条件返回不同的结果。假设我们有一组学生的成绩,需要根据成绩划分等级。

1. 基本概念

IF函数的基本语法为:=IF(逻辑判断, 真值, 假值)。我们可以通过嵌套多个IF函数来实现多条件判断。

2. 示例

假设学生成绩在A列,从A2开始,我们要根据以下标准划分等级:

  • 90分及以上为A
  • 80分到89分为B
  • 70分到79分为C
  • 60分到69分为D
  • 60分以下为F

那么,我们可以在B2单元格中输入以下公式:

=IF(A2>=90, "A", IF(A2>=80, "B", IF(A2>=70, "C", IF(A2>=60, "D", "F"))))

然后将公式向下拖动应用到其他单元格中,即可得到每个学生的等级。

二、VLOOKUP函数求等级

VLOOKUP函数 是用于在表格的第一列中查找值,然后返回同一行指定列中的值。它非常适合用于查找和引用数据。用VLOOKUP函数求等级时,需要先创建一个查找表。

1. 创建查找表

首先在工作表的空白区域创建一个查找表,例如在D列和E列:

D列 E列
0 F
60 D
70 C
80 B
90 A

2. 使用VLOOKUP函数

假设学生成绩在A列,从A2开始,我们可以在B2单元格中输入以下公式:

=VLOOKUP(A2, $D$2:$E$6, 2, TRUE)

然后将公式向下拖动应用到其他单元格中,即可得到每个学生的等级。

三、RANK函数求等级

RANK函数 用于返回指定数字在一组数字中的排名。它可以根据数值的大小来排列数据,适合用于求相对等级。

1. 基本概念

RANK函数的基本语法为:=RANK(数值, 数值区域, [排序顺序])。排序顺序为0表示降序,为1表示升序。

2. 示例

假设学生成绩在A列,从A2开始,我们可以在B2单元格中输入以下公式:

=RANK(A2, $A$2:$A$11, 0)

然后将公式向下拖动应用到其他单元格中,即可得到每个学生的排名。我们可以根据排名将学生划分为不同等级,例如前20%为A,20%-40%为B,依此类推。

四、综合应用

在实际应用中,我们可以结合使用上述多个函数来实现更复杂的需求。例如,我们可以使用RANK函数对数据进行排名,然后根据排名使用IF函数或VLOOKUP函数求等级。

1. 结合RANK和IF函数

假设学生成绩在A列,从A2开始,首先在B2单元格中输入以下公式计算排名:

=RANK(A2, $A$2:$A$11, 0)

然后在C2单元格中输入以下公式根据排名求等级:

=IF(B2<=2, "A", IF(B2<=4, "B", IF(B2<=6, "C", IF(B2<=8, "D", "F"))))

2. 结合RANK和VLOOKUP函数

假设学生成绩在A列,从A2开始,首先在B2单元格中输入以下公式计算排名:

=RANK(A2, $A$2:$A$11, 0)

然后创建一个查找表,例如在D列和E列:

D列 E列
1 A
3 B
5 C
7 D
9 F

最后在C2单元格中输入以下公式根据排名求等级:

=VLOOKUP(B2, $D$2:$E$6, 2, TRUE)

五、注意事项

  1. 数据范围:在使用RANK函数时,要确保数值区域包含所有需要排名的数据。
  2. 查找表:在使用VLOOKUP函数时,查找表必须按照升序排列。
  3. 逻辑判断:在使用IF函数时,逻辑判断条件要全面覆盖所有可能情况。
  4. 公式复制:在公式中使用绝对引用(如$A$2:$A$11)可以避免在复制公式时引用区域发生变化。

通过以上方法,你可以在Excel中灵活地求出等级,无论是单一条件判断还是复杂的数据查找,都可以通过不同函数的组合来实现。希望这些方法能够帮助你更有效地处理数据。

相关问答FAQs:

1. 在Excel中如何计算等级?

要在Excel中计算等级,您可以使用VLOOKUP函数或IF函数来实现。VLOOKUP函数可以根据给定的值在一个范围内查找并返回相应的等级。而IF函数可以根据条件判断给出相应的等级。

2. 如何使用VLOOKUP函数来计算等级?

使用VLOOKUP函数来计算等级非常简单。首先,您需要创建一个包含等级和相应值的表格。然后,在要计算等级的单元格中,使用VLOOKUP函数,将要查找的值作为第一个参数,表格作为第二个参数,等级所在列的索引作为第三个参数,最后一个参数设置为FALSE,以确保精确匹配。这样,Excel会根据给定的值在表格中查找并返回相应的等级。

3. 如何使用IF函数来计算等级?

使用IF函数来计算等级也很简单。您可以使用IF函数的嵌套来设置多个条件,并给出相应的等级。例如,您可以使用IF函数来判断一个值是否大于等于某个阈值,并给出相应的等级。如果条件为真,则返回相应的等级,否则返回其他等级。这样,您可以根据不同的条件设置不同的等级,从而实现等级的计算。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4253438

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部